html,body,body.gradient{background:#fff!important;margin:0;padding:0}main#MainContent{margin:0;padding:0}.skip-to-content-link{display:none!important}.sa-header{display:flex;justify-content:space-between;align-items:center;padding:1.4rem 2rem;background:rgb(var(--color-background));color:rgb(var(--color-foreground))}.sa-header__link{text-decoration:none;letter-spacing:var(--sa-tracking-label, .12em);font-size:.78rem;font-weight:400;text-transform:uppercase;color:inherit}.sa-header__link:hover{text-decoration:underline;text-underline-offset:.25em}.sa-header__count{display:inline-block}.sa-hero{display:grid;grid-template-columns:1fr 1fr;width:100%;height:calc(100vh - 70px);min-height:600px;margin:0;padding:0;overflow:hidden}.sa-hero__half{position:relative;overflow:hidden;background:#1a1a1a}.sa-hero__image{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;display:block}.sa-hero__image--default{opacity:1;z-index:1}.sa-hero__image--hover{opacity:0;z-index:2}.sa-hero__half:hover .sa-hero__image--default{opacity:0}.sa-hero__half:hover .sa-hero__image--hover{opacity:1}@media(hover:none){.sa-hero__image--hover{display:none}}.sa-hero .sa-hero__wordmark,img.sa-hero__wordmark{position:absolute!important;top:50%!important;left:50%!important;transform:translate(calc(-50% + var(--sa-wm-x, 0%)),calc(-50% + var(--sa-wm-y, 0%)))!important;z-index:3;height:var(--sa-wm-size, 120px)!important;width:auto!important;max-width:90%!important;aspect-ratio:auto!important;pointer-events:none;-webkit-user-select:none;user-select:none;display:block;transition:transform 80ms ease,height 80ms ease}@media(max-width:749px){.sa-hero .sa-hero__wordmark,img.sa-hero__wordmark{height:calc(var(--sa-wm-size, 120px) * .55)!important}}@media(max-width:749px){.sa-hero{grid-template-columns:1fr;height:auto;min-height:0}.sa-hero__half{height:50vh;min-height:320px}.sa-hero__word{font-size:clamp(2.2rem,14vw,4.5rem)}}.sa-tagline{padding-left:2rem;padding-right:2rem;display:flex;justify-content:center;text-align:center}.sa-tagline__inner{max-width:720px;letter-spacing:var(--sa-tracking-label, .12em);font-size:.82rem;text-transform:uppercase;line-height:1.7}.sa-tagline__inner p{margin:0}:root{--sa-tracking-display: .18em;--sa-tracking-label: .12em;--sa-max-width: 1440px}body{color:rgb(var(--color-foreground));font-weight:400}.page-width{max-width:var(--sa-max-width)}h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6{font-weight:300;letter-spacing:var(--sa-tracking-display);text-transform:uppercase}.banner__heading,.banner__heading *{letter-spacing:var(--sa-tracking-display);font-weight:300}.card__heading,.card__information .price,.card-information,.card-information *{text-transform:uppercase;letter-spacing:var(--sa-tracking-label);font-size:.78rem;font-weight:400}.card__heading a{text-decoration:none}.price__regular .price-item,.price__sale .price-item{font-weight:400}.product__title h1,.product__title .h1{font-size:clamp(2.4rem,4vw,3.6rem);letter-spacing:var(--sa-tracking-display);line-height:1.05}.product__info-wrapper .price{font-size:1rem;font-weight:400;letter-spacing:var(--sa-tracking-label)}.product__description p{font-size:.875rem;line-height:1.55}.button,.shopify-payment-button__button--unbranded{border-radius:9999px!important;letter-spacing:var(--sa-tracking-label);text-transform:uppercase;font-weight:400;padding-inline:2.2rem}.header__heading-logo,.header__heading-link{letter-spacing:var(--sa-tracking-display);font-weight:300;text-transform:uppercase}.header__menu-item{letter-spacing:var(--sa-tracking-label);text-transform:uppercase;font-size:.8rem;font-weight:400}.header__icon--search,.header__icon--account,details-modal:has(.header__icon--search){display:none!important}.header__icon--cart .svg-wrapper{display:none}.header__icon--cart{width:auto;height:auto;padding-inline:.4rem;display:inline-flex;align-items:center}.header__icon--cart:after{content:"CART";letter-spacing:var(--sa-tracking-label);font-size:.8rem;font-weight:400;text-transform:uppercase}.cart-count-bubble{margin-left:.4rem;position:static;transform:none;background:transparent;color:rgb(var(--color-foreground))}.footer-block__heading{letter-spacing:var(--sa-tracking-label);font-size:.85rem;text-transform:uppercase;font-weight:500}.footer-block__details-content a{text-decoration:none}.footer-block__details-content a:hover{text-decoration:underline;text-underline-offset:.25em}.collection .grid--peek:has(li:not(.grid__item)),.section-featured-collection .collection__title:has(+slider-component .grid:empty){display:none}.image-banner-wrapper .banner__media img{object-fit:contain}@media screen and (min-width:750px){.grid-product .grid__item{padding:0 .4rem}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/surfatelier.css.map */
